Highly Transparent Mg_(0.27)Al_(2.58)O_(3.73)N_(0.27) Ceramic Prepared by Pressureless Sintering

摘要

A novel aluminum magnesium oxynitride transparent ceramic with the chemical formula Mg_(0.27)Al_(2.58)O_(3.73)N_(0.27) was firstly prepared by pressureless sintering of fine single-phase powders at 1875℃ for 24 h in nitrogen atmosphere. The ceramic was fully dense with the average grain size of 57.5 urn. The sample showed excellent in-line transmission from the visible to middle-infrared wavelengths with the maximum transmittance of 84%, which could be attributed to rare pores in the sintering body. The material also exhibited good mechanical properties of Vickers hardness (13.39 ± 0.18 GPa), fracture toughness (2.46 ± 0.3 MPa/m~(1/2)), and flexural strength (274 ± 6 MPa).
机译:首先通过在氮气氛中于1875℃下无压烧结24 h制备了化学式为Mg_(0.27)Al_(2.58)O_(3.73)N_(0.27)的新型铝氧氮化铝透明陶瓷。陶瓷完全致密,平均晶粒尺寸为57.5微米。样品显示出从可见光到中红外波长的出色在线透射,最大透射率为84%,这可能归因于烧结体中的稀有孔。该材料还表现出良好的机械性能,包括维氏硬度(13.39±0.18 GPa),断裂韧性(2.46±0.3 MPa / m〜(1/2))和抗弯强度(274±6 MPa)。
